WebJul 1, 2012 · The exact demarcation among dolichocephalic, mesaticephalic, and brachycephalic head conformations is poorly defined; 1 author 1 classified dogs as brachycephalic, mesaticephalic, or dolichocephalic on the basis of a ratio of skull width to skull length of 0.81, 0.52, or 0.39, respectively. WebCanine skull shape ranges from brachycephalic (short and wide cranial proportions, i.e. ‘flat-faced’; breeds such as the bulldog, pug and boxer) to dolichocephalic (long muzzle, long and narrow cranial proportions; breeds such as the greyhound, Saluki and collie), with mesaticephalic (also known as mesocephalic; medium muzzle length and ...

Radiographic exams depicting differences in skull shape among dolichocephalic, mesaticephalic and brachycephalic newborn puppies. … WebIn anthropometry, the cephalic index has been the favored measurement. A cephalic index of 80 or more is called brachycephalic or broad; a measurement between 75 and 80 is mesaticephalic; below 75 is considered dolicocephalic or long.
